Founded in 1970’s, ALTESINO consists of three vineyards located NE of the village of Montalcino: Montosoli, La Velona and Altesino itself. The town is on a hill at an elevation of around 600m, which protects the Montosoli vineyard to the north, which lies at 390m. Altesino Brunello is sourced from a combination of these three vineyards, and in excellent vintages they produce a single vineyard Brunello “Montosoli.

Montosoli covers just 4 ha and is unusual in its north and NW exposure, rather than the sun-facing south. It is characterized by slightly lower temperatures, especially at night, so the flowering is a little longer and usually later than other areas. The hang-time at Montosoli is longer and it is usually the last vineyard to be harvested, a couple of days after Altesino and often 15 days after La Velona. The cooler microclimate is beneficial during summers of intense heat.

“Montosoli” is a five-hectare vineyard  northeast of Montalcino at an altitude of 350-400m. The grapes from this vineyard have been fermented and aged separately since the 1975 harvest.

SIRO PACENTI, Montalcino
“Giancarlo Pacenti farms 20 ha of Sangiovese vineyards, the vast majority of which are Brunello-designated. Pacenti is one of the few producers who believes in bottling a single Brunello made from plots across various zones within Montalcino, which he believes leads to wines of greater complexity and balance. Pacenti employs a Bordeaux-like model where only the best lots are bottled into the Brunello, which he considers his ‘Grand Vin,’ while the secondary lots are bottled as Rosso di Montalcino. These are wines of the very highest level, and I can’t recommend them highly enough.” -Wine Advocate
